KUALA LUMPUR (Bernama): A moderate earthquake measuring 4.7 on the Richter scale hit Kudat, Sabah, at 9.58am on Tuesday (June 30).
The Malaysian Meteorological Department, in a statement, said the epicentre of the quake was at 6.92 degrees north and 116.37 degrees east, at a depth of 629km, some 47km west of Kudat.
